Latex or Nitrile Gloves: Finding the Perfect Fit
When selecting the appropriate gloves, the choice check here between nitrile and latex often presents a dilemma. Both materials offer superior barrier protection against hazardous substances, but their characteristics vary significantly. Latex gloves are renowned for their sensitivity, making them ideal for precise tasks. However, they may trigger allergic reactions in some individuals. On the other hand, nitrile gloves provide a more durable barrier against chemicals and punctures while being hypoallergenic. Consider your specific needs and potential allergies when making your decision.
- Choose nitrile gloves if working with strong acids.
- Latex gloves are ideal for tasks requiring high touch.

Guidelines for with Nitrile Gloves
When operating with substances, it's crucial to prioritize your safety. Nitrile gloves offer a robust barrier against contamination. In order to achieve their performance, follow these essential guidelines:
* Always inspect your gloves before implementation for any punctures.
* Choose the correct nitrile glove gauge based on the application.
* Refrain from coming in contact with irritants outside the gloves.
* Wash your hands thoroughly before and after removing your gloves.
* Discard used gloves properly according to safety regulations.
